I recently had the pleasure of dining at Ashoka Biryani, and I must say that it exceeded my expectations in every way. Located in a vibrant neighborhood, this restaurant offers a delightful ambiance, excellent service, and, most importantly, a wide variety of delicious biryanis. Without a doubt, the Chicken Dum Biryani stood out as the star of the show.
Upon entering Ashoka Biryani, I was greeted by friendly and attentive staff who promptly seated me. The restaurant had a clean and inviting atmosphere, with tasteful decorations that reflected its Indian heritage. The seating arrangement was comfortable, and the overall ambiance was relaxed and welcoming.
Now, let's talk about the main attraction - the Chicken Dum Biryani. As a biryani enthusiast, I have tried this classic dish in numerous restaurants, but the one at Ashoka Biryani truly stood out. The aroma alone was enough to make my mouth water. The basmati rice was perfectly cooked, each grain distinct and fluffy, while the succulent chicken pieces were tender and packed with flavor. The spices used in the biryani were well-balanced, giving it a delightful blend of fragrant and mild heat. The dish was served with raita, which provided a refreshing contrast to the rich flavors of the biryani. Every bite was a delight, and I found myself savoring each morsel until the very last grain of rice.
Aside from the Chicken Dum Biryani, Ashoka Biryani also offers a diverse menu with a range of biryani options, including vegetarian and seafood variations. I had the chance to sample a few other dishes as well, such as the Vegetable Biryani and the Prawn Biryani, and they were equally impressive. The quality and taste of the ingredients were consistently exceptional.
The service at Ashoka Biryani was top-notch. The staff was attentive, knowledgeable, and ready to assist with any inquiries or recommendations. The food was served promptly, and the portion sizes were generous, ensuring that I left the restaurant satisfied.
Overall, my experience at Ashoka Biryani was fantastic, and I highly recommend it to anyone looking for an exceptional biryani dining experience. The Chicken Dum Biryani, in particular, was the highlight of my meal, showcasing the chef's skillful preparation and dedication to quality.
